Output db6f690805a19f2c3d26fe5495cc0f1acfc6287ceea6d9e95bf3bb5579a34f95:2

value
65516331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37671507eb22d262eb8cd0a9280c96f8ca079 OP_EQUAL
address
3BMEXmXkSrzf3nnWsQAPAeCjB4PoYc8Ffz
transaction
db6f690805a19f2c3d26fe5495cc0f1acfc6287ceea6d9e95bf3bb5579a34f95
confirmations
348726
spent
true